Media personality Dex has expressed his thoughts calmly regarding the controversy surrounding his recommendation of the controversial Japanese series “Made In Abyss.”

On the afternoon of the 23rd of November, MBC held a press conference for the new variety program ‘Born to Travel the World’ season 3, Dex was among the attendees.

‘Born to Travel the World’ is a variety program that follows the travel bucket list of Gian84, a popular webtoon artist and broadcaster known as the “man who was born to live.” Dex is the youngest member of the ‘Born to Travel the World’ series.

Dex has been caught up in controversy recently. He has been criticized for introducing and recommending the Japanese anime “Made in Abyss” on his personal YouTube channel, the anime and original manga contains scenes of young children’s nudity, sexual violence, and human experimentation, and is considered to have a pedophilic tendency. Some argue that “Made in Abyss” is a story about a girl named Riko who goes on an adventure to excavate relics and has formed a cult following with its cute art style, so Dex was simply recommending the work. However, there have also been voices demanding Dex to take responsibility for his statements, given his recent popularity.

During the press conference for “World Tour 3,” there was also a direct question asking for Dex’s opinion on this issue. As he is considered a “trend,” it was also a question about his thoughts on the inevitable attention and fame. Kim Ji-woo, the PD, first took the microphone to protect the cast members and apologized, saying, “I’m sorry, but this is a place for the program, so I hope we can talk about the program as much as possible. This question seems difficult for the cast members to answer right now. I apologize.” MC Jang Do-yeon also stepped in, saying, “It’s a place for the program,” and supported Kim Ji-woo PD.

However, Dex did not avoid controversy. He calmly said, “Since you asked the question, I will answer it sincerely. I don’t think you need to worry too much. I have always lived my life with a clear focus. It seems clear to me, but I have realized that it can be seen as a problem by others. Everyone has lived their own life and experienced different things, so I think this issue arises from different perspectives. Nevertheless, I will continue to maintain my focus and try to balance things well without causing concerns.”

Many other idols have also been criticized for either watching or recommending the anime.
